Output 6560c3325042156fdc90c7e1c0ebbd9361a9cda6777e953bf05eec9907b686d7:1

value
603668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 268a6028c845cfc3c6c9028faae187610fb057ff OP_EQUALVERIFY OP_CHECKSIG
address
14WnSoBuhXXJKH92exvmSKmiPeSSkLbwXX
transaction
6560c3325042156fdc90c7e1c0ebbd9361a9cda6777e953bf05eec9907b686d7
spent
true